How Heat Resistant Is Granite . Cracks and burns caused by high heat can drastically reduce the life and original beauty of your counter. Granite countertops are heat resistant but heat can damage them if not properly handled. Granite countertops are highly resistant to heat, withstanding temperatures up to 1,200 degrees fahrenheit without damage. In terms of heat resistance, granite is a much better choice. For example, granite is considered heatproof, but some people suggest it’s only heat resistant, so it’s wise to err on the side of caution and place hot pots and pans on a trivet. Long exposure to the sun can cause the countertop to feel rough when you rub your hand across the surface.
